An Idea Borrowed

Years ago on a radio program someone shared that they read a chapter in Proverbs every day. Since there are 31 chapters and the longest month has 31 days it allows you to read through Proverbs on a regular basis. I use it as the launch pad for my personal worship time and branch out from there. On this blog I will try to share some of the insights I have in the Word. The Smell of Burning Pants

(Proverbs 7:15 KJV)  Therefore came I forth to meet thee, diligently to seek thy face, and I have found thee.

They lie.  I know it is hard to accept but telling the truth is becoming the weird behavior of our times.  The women doing the talking is giving the impression that she was really excited about meeting this fool.  In reality she is preparing a sheep for the slaughter. 

They lie.  I used to have a speech class and the last speech was “Five Principles on Which I Base My Life”.  It was a real challenge to explain what I meant by that.  The idea of basing life on principles was beyond their understanding.  Once we got going they showed they still did not understand.  What was more frustrating was the number of young people who would say that speaking the truth was a principle.  Before you get excited and high fiving you need to realize that the next sentence was something to the effect of, “I always tell the truth...except when it hurts me.”

So?  We are expected to speak truth.  Liars will burn in hell.  Don’t expect the world around you to return the favor.
